What Lies Behind Your Walls

The Hidden Challenges of Older Bathrooms

North York homes built before 1950 present renovation challenges that newer homes do not. We find them regularly, and we plan for them before we start.

Renovation specialist inspecting an older North York bathroom before demolition

Galvanized Steel Pipes

Original plumbing in homes from the 1920s to 1960s used galvanized steel. These pipes corrode from the inside, restricting water flow and eventually failing. We replace them with modern copper or PEX, which means opening walls and rerouting lines. We budget for that properly.

Dated Tiles and Adhesives

Materials installed decades ago are not always safe to disturb. We identify suspect materials early, bring in the right certified specialists when needed, and document everything. It can add time and cost, but cutting corners is not worth the risk to your health.

Lath and Plaster Walls

Instead of drywall, older bathrooms have walls of plaster over wooden lath. These are messy to demolish, brittle around pipe penetrations, and prone to moisture damage. We account for the extra demo time and know how to support structures as we open them.

Tired Subfloors and Joists

Years of bathroom moisture without proper ventilation can soften the subfloor and weaken joists. A bathroom that feels spongy underfoot is a red flag. We inspect the substructure carefully, replace damaged sections, and install proper ventilation so it does not happen again.

Aging Electrical

Some older North York homes still have remnants of very early wiring. It tells you the age of the electrical system. We work with licensed electricians to bring bathroom circuits up to current standards: new outlets, proper GFCI protection, and grounding.

Inadequate Ventilation

Many older bathrooms have exhaust fans that vent into the attic instead of outside. That traps moisture upstairs, damages roof framing, and encourages mold. We reroute ventilation properly through the soffit or roof, protecting your home's structure.

The Foundation of Longevity

Why Waterproofing Matters More in Older Homes

Schluter Kerdi linear drain installed during a North York shower waterproofing

We Use Schluter Kerdi on Every Project

Schluter Kerdi is a sheet-based waterproofing membrane. It bonds to your substrate and creates a continuous, flexible barrier. Water does not sit and it cannot penetrate. In an older home with a questionable subfloor, that makes all the difference.

Older Homes Need Redundancy

A single membrane is not enough on its own. We layer it: proper substrate, Kerdi waterproofing, sealed penetrations, grout, sealant. If one layer is challenged, the others catch the water. In a century home where moisture has already done damage, that redundancy is your insurance.

Corners and Transitions Are Critical

Failures happen at transitions: where walls meet floors, where pipes penetrate, where the shower pan slopes to the drain. We detail these carefully with Kerdi reinforcement, sealed corners, and proper slope, so water never finds its way into your joists.

Transparent Pricing

What to Budget for a North York Bathroom Renovation

Standard Bathroom

From $15,000. New fixtures, tile, waterproofing, and standard plumbing with no structural surprises. Many newer homes fall in this range.

Century Home with Structural Work

$18,000 to $30,000+. Budget for subfloor repair, full replumbing, rewiring, and ventilation upgrades. An older bungalow typically needs more work.

Walk-In Shower or Layout Changes

From $13,000. Rerouting plumbing, structural changes, and premium waterproofing. The older the home, the more we plan for the unexpected.

Why does my bathroom exhaust fan vent into the attic?
Older homes often had fans vented into the attic. It was easier to install, but it is hard on your home. The trapped moisture damages roof framing and encourages mold. We reroute the duct so it exhausts outside through the soffit or roof.
What happens if you find soft joists during demo?
We stop, document it, and walk you through the options. Typically we sister new joists alongside the damaged ones or replace sections entirely. It adds some cost and time, but a soft floor is not safe to build on. We plan for this possibility in century homes so it is not a shock.
